Robert “Woody” Woodbury (born February 9, 1924) is an American comedian, actor, television personality and talk show host. He is perhaps best known for his best-selling comedy albums of risqué stories, most of which were released in the early 1960s. Woodbury was among the first standup comedians to receive a gold record.Woodbury was a US Marine Corps fighter pilot in World War II and Korea.Appearing at a night club in Florida, Woodbury met Fletcher Smith who recorded Woody's material and through his connections in Hollywood led Woodbury to appear in a few films.
